Job Description
Data Analyst
Connexus Credit Union
• Independently builds and maintains KPIs, dashboards, reports, and data related products. • Independently gathers and prepares large, complex datasets from diverse sources. • Performs exploratory and statistical analyses to uncover deeper trends and insights. • Independently answers complex business questions with data-driven and actionable recommendations. • Designs and delivers sophisticated dashboards and custom reports for diverse audiences. • Adapts visualizations to communicate technical findings to non-technical stakeholders effectively. • Leads discussions with business units to deeply understand data needs and proactively suggest solutions. • Educates stakeholders on advanced analytics techniques and best practices for secure data handling. • Represents D&I team on ePMO projects ensuring timely delivery of assignments • Mentors associate data analysts to ensure data integrity and consistency. • Leads automation projects to streamline complex workflows and improve efficiency. • Serves as a trusted partner to leadership, providing insights that shape strategic decisions and drive operational success. • Partners with data scientists and engineers on multidisciplinary projects.
Job Requirements
- Bachelor's degree or commensurate experience is Required.
- 5+ years of data, analytics, dashboard, report writing, or Business Intelligence programming and development work is Required.
- Proficient in SQL, Excel, and Python for advanced analysis is Required.
- Experience optimizing queries and workflows in centralized data warehouses (e.g., Snowflake, Databricks, etc.) is Required.
- Experience creating polished dashboards and visualizations in Power BI is Required.
- Microsoft Certified: Power BI Data Analyst Associate
